Cad Engineer Reveals How To Write Macros For Catia V5, A 3d Cad Program Used In The Automotive And Aerospace Industries.
With this VB Scripting for CATIA V5: Expanded Edition eBook you can learn to create the perfect macro to automate your time consuming processes. If you hired an engineering services company to write macros for you or your company it would cost you thousands of dollars. Why not teach yourself and impresses your bosses? The evolution of an engineer is all about continuous learning.
I’ve created hundreds of macros and included some example codes in the book. This 159 page ebook come as a downloadable pdf file which you can view right on your PC; eReader not required!
The seven tutorials include the following topics:
Workshop 1: Fundamentals
How to add a macro library
How to open and run macros
How to create an icon for your macros
Create a “hello” message box macro
Workshop 2: Creating Your Own VBA Modules and Classes
Create a new class module in a new VBA library named “Messenger”.
Give the Messenger class a simple “Public” property and use the class in a CATIA macro.
Enhance the Messenger class so that the “getting” and “setting” of its properties are controlled by “Get” and “Let” methods.
Give the Messenger class a method called “Capitalize” that serves to manipulate the string information that is stored in its properties.
Workshop 3: Creating a Basic VBA Program from Scratch
Create a new module in the macro library created in Workshop 2 called myVBA_01
Program a routine that creates two integer variables, adds them, and then displays the result in a “message box”.
Create a new module with a routine using a Sub
Create a new module with a routine using a Function
Create a new module with a routine using arrays and a For loop.
Workshop 4: Objects in CATIA VBA
Create a new module in the macro library myVBA_01.
Start an “empty” CATMain() Sub.
Observe the properties and methods of the CATIA object.
Grab the Documents collection and display its Count property.
Workshop 5: Navigating a Part Document with Error Handling
Create a new CATPart in CATIA and create a new CATIA VBA library and module.
Use error handling in your code to check that the active document is a part document
Have the program count the number of sketch based features using error handling
Workshop 6: Creating Sketch Geometry
Start a new macro recording.
Create a sketch on the Y-Z plane that consists of a single line.
Open the recorded macro and observe what has been recorded.
Modify the macro to create additional geometry and rerun it on a new part document.
Workshop 7: Using Forms in CATIA VBA
Create a form in the macro library
Create various buttons and fields in the form.
Re-use code from an earlier workshop in order to add CATIA functionality and interactivity
I Want to take this book,can you please share me how to purchage hard copy and where to purchage "vb scripting for catia v5 " in Bangalore India,with author name book title pls share to my Email ID thans & regards
sangamnath
by clickbank
Must Have Extensions For The 500,000+ Downloaded Newsletter Wordpress Plugin. Automated Emails, Follow Up, Reports, Facebook One Click Subscription...
by clickbank
High Conversions! Great For Any B2b Or B2c Website. Simply The Tedious Task Of Graphics Design & Content Creation. With Digitalpaper Anybody Can Cr...
by clickbank
Never Lose That Precious Memory Again. Our Automatic Cloud Based Backup Software Safely And Securely Backs Up Your Files. Your Data Is Encrypted Us...
by clickbank
Awesome Visual Sales Pages Is A Set Of Psd Templates For Creating Visual Type Of Sales Pages. Pretty Much All The Biggest IM Forum Launches Use The...
by clickbank
This Online Course Is Proven To Get Beginners Up And Running With Traktor Pro 2 Software. The Course Focuses On The Wordls Most Popular Dj Controll...
by clickbank
In This Step-by-step Video Training, I Take The User From Css Beginner To Pro. The Training Is Very Interactive The User Gets To Download Mini-webs...
by clickbank
Make Money Through This High Converting Premium Wordpress Install Service. Conversion Rates Are Very High Meaning You Make More Money. People You R...
by clickbank
This Ebook Has Gathered The Best Solutions Posted On The Internet (blogs,forums,manuals,etc) Combined With The 10 Years Of PC Repair Experience Of ...
by clickbank
Noble IT Is A Computer Consultant, Service Delivery And Support It Business In Sydney, Australia. We Are Proud Creators Of Step-by-step Guides To H...
by clickbank
Amazing New Ebook Written By A Passionate Expert In The Field Of Java Programming. This Ebook Has Sold Very Well And Reached Amazon's #1 Bestseller...
by clickbank
The Genius Maker. Activate Your Infinite Potential, Ignite Your Creativity, Get 10, 20, 100x More Things Done, Remove The Bottlenecks Holding You B...
sangamnath